| Bridge Project On NH 103 Over Stevens Brook In Warner
Deck Rehabilitation Work To Take Four Months The New Hampshire Department of Transportation announces work is getting underway on the rehabilitation of the NH Route 103 bridge over Stevens Brook in Warner. This bridge is located immediately east of the I-89 Exit 9 northbound ramps. This bridge rehabilitation project includes full deck repairs, and paving work on the bridge and roadway approaches. Traffic during the project is scheduled to be shifted in three phases. Alternating traffic will be in place during set-up and paving operations. Two lanes of traffic will be maintained for most of the project, which is expected to take four months to complete. BUR Construction, LLC of Claremont, New Hampshire is the general contractor for the $304,000 project. The scheduled completion date is August 19, 2011. |
